Merge tag 'stable/for-linus-3.13-rc4-tag' of git://git.kernel.org/pub/scm/linux/kernel/git/xen/tip

Pull Xen bugfixes from Konrad Rzeszutek Wilk:
 - Fix balloon driver for auto-translate guests (PVHVM, ARM) to not use
   scratch pages.
 - Fix block API header for ARM32 and ARM64 to have proper layout
 - On ARM when mapping guests, stick on PTE_SPECIAL
 - When using SWIOTLB under ARM, don't call swiotlb functions twice
 - When unmapping guests memory and if we fail, don't return pages which
   failed to be unmapped.
 - Grant driver was using the wrong address on ARM.

* tag 'stable/for-linus-3.13-rc4-tag' of git://git.kernel.org/pub/scm/linux/kernel/git/xen/tip:
  xen/balloon: Seperate the auto-translate logic properly (v2)
  xen/block: Correctly define structures in public headers on ARM32 and ARM64
  arm: xen: foreign mapping PTEs are special.
  xen/arm64: do not call the swiotlb functions twice
  xen: privcmd: do not return pages which we have failed to unmap
  XEN: Grant table address, xen_hvm_resume_frames, is a phys_addr not a pfn
